(a)  Subject to the hearing provisions of § 7-314 of this
subtitle, the Board may deny a license to any applicant,
reprimand any licensee, place any licensee on probation, or
suspend or revoke the license of a licensee if the applicant or
licensee:

(12)  Is professionally, physically, or mentally
incompetent; [or]

(13)  Knowingly fails to report suspected child abuse
in violation of § 5-903 of the Family Law Article; OR

(14)  REFUSES, WITHHOLDS FROM, DENIES, OR
DISCRIMINATES AGAINST AN INDIVIDUAL WITH REGARD TO THE PROVISION
OF PROFESSIONAL SERVICES FOR WHICH THE LICENSEE IS LICENSED AND
QUALIFIED TO RENDER BECAUSE OF THE INDIVIDUAL'S MENTAL OR
PHYSICAL HANDICAP THE INDIVIDUAL IS HIV POSITIVE.

8-313.

(b)  Subject to the hearing provisions of § 8-314 of this
subtitle, the Board may deny a license or limited license to any
applicant, reprimand any licensee or holder of a limited license,
place any licensee or holder of a limited license on probation,
or suspend or revoke a license or limited license if the
applicant, holder, or licensee:

(10)  Submits a false statement to collect a fee; [or]

(11)  Commits an act of unprofessional conduct in the
licensee's practice as a nursing home administrator; OR

(12)  REFUSES, WITHHOLDS FROM, DENIES, OR
DISCRIMINATES AGAINST AN INDIVIDUAL WITH REGARD TO THE PROVISION
OF PROFESSIONAL SERVICES FOR WHICH THE LICENSEE IS LICENSED AND
QUALIFIED TO RENDER BECAUSE OF THE INDIVIDUAL'S MENTAL OR
PHYSICAL HANDICAP THE INDIVIDUAL IS HIV POSITIVE.
